Hydrocodone is a drug that is derived from opiates. It is available only in combination with acetaminophen or ibuprofen, both non-opiate derived drugs. It requires a prescription from a licensed doctor. In most combinations, the strength of hydrocodene is 5, 7.5 or 10 mg. The greater the milligrams, the greater the amount of the drug.
Yes, the hydrocodone 10-325 pills are stronger than the white 5-500 pills. The primary active ingredient is hydrocodone, and the dose of this compound is given by the first number. The second number is the dose of the secondary ingredient, acetaminophen (APAP). APAP is the same active ingredient as in Tylenol, and it is primarily added to discourage abuse of opioid painkillers. APAP does not have any narcotic properties. Additionally, APAP is very toxic to the liver in overdose; the maximum safe dose per day is 4000mg. Thus, the 10-325 pills have twice the primary ingredient, and have less dangerous APAP.

'Watson 853' refers to the imprint of a narcotic analgesic drug. The pill is oblong, scored, and of pale yellow color and is manufactured by Watson Pharmaceuticals, Inc. It contains 10 mg hydrocodone bitartrate and 325 mg APAP (acetaminophen a.k.a. "Tylenol") In fact, 'Watson 853' is a generic version of name brands Vicodin, Norco and Lortab.
